cPanel web hosting versus CLOUD WEBSITE HOSTING

How many of the cPanel-based reseller hosting suppliers out there provide authentic cloud hosting services? Let's not ignore, cPanel was created for and still works only on one hosting server. In no less than ninety nine point ninety nine percent of the cPanel installations in the world, cPanel runs on a single web server. To cut a long story short, the cPanel-based web page hosting platform is a one-server-does-it-all type of a site hosting platform. All disk space, mail, database, FTP, webspace hosting CP, DNS, etc. tasks are being served simultaneously on one web server.

Single-server web site hosting systems: the queue predicament

Here's an illustration: it's like running eight software applications simultaneously on your personal computer. The computer's performance invariably slows down noticeably, because of the fact that now there is a big queue with requests waiting to be served or carried out (created by these 8 software programs running at one and the same time).
